The Experience

In addition to regional cultural discoveries, and contacts with expatriates from many European countries, this stay near the beaches, just on the Spanish-Portuguese border, is more a place for linguistic and cultural exchange. There's very little actual work, it's more about contact. The host can also introduce you to photography, contact with animals and French and Iberian cuisine.

Brazil

5

Foi meu primeiro voluntariado, fui bem recebida por Jean Paul e Simba seu cachorro. A experiências foram boas não tarefas eram simples , não tem muito o que fazer . O anfitrião me levou para conhecer a região , conhece várias cidades da redondezas, fiz vários passeios com ele e o Simba. Tive meu próprio dormitório e banheiro, as refeições eram muito boas, Jean cozinhava e sempre fazíamos 1 refeição fora de casa. A residência fica afastada das cidades , mas dentro do condomínio tem ônibus que leva até a cidade caso precise.
